| /* PSA wait timeouts */ |
| #define PSA_POLL (0x00000000u) |
| #define PSA_BLOCK (0x80000000u) |
| |
| /* doorbell signal */ |
| #define PSA_DOORBELL (0x00000008u) |
| |
| /* PSA message types */ |
| #define PSA_IPC_CONNECT (1) |
| #define PSA_IPC_CALL (2) |
| #define PSA_IPC_DISCONNECT (3) |
| |
| /* PSA response types */ |
| #define PSA_CONNECTION_ACCEPTED (0) |
| |
| /* maximum number of input and output vectors */ |
| #define PSA_MAX_IOVEC (4) |
| |
| typedef uint32_t psa_signal_t; |
| |
| /** |
| * Describes a message received by a RoT Service after calling \ref psa_get(). |
| */ |
| typedef struct psa_msg_t { |
| uint32_t type; |
| psa_handle_t handle; |
| void *rhandle; |
| size_t in_size[PSA_MAX_IOVEC]; |
| size_t out_size[PSA_MAX_IOVEC]; |
| } psa_msg_t; |
| |
| /* ******** ******** PSA Secure Function API ******** ******** */ |
| |
| /** |
| * \brief Returns the set of signals that have been asserted for a Sercure |
| * Partition. |
| * |
| * \param[in] timeout Specify either blocking or polling operation |
| * |
| * \retval >0 At least one signal is asserted |
| * \retval 0 No signals are asserted. This is only seen if the |
| * caller used a polling timeout |
| */ |
| uint32_t psa_wait_any(uint32_t timeout); |
| |
| /** |
| * \brief Returns the Secure Partition interrupt signals that have been |
| * asserted from the subset of signals indicated in the bitmask provided. |
| * |
| * \param[in] signal_mask A set of interrupt and doorbell signals to query. |
| * Signals that are not in this set will be ignored |
| * \param[in] timeout Specify either blocking or polling operation |
| * |
| * \retval >0 At least one signal is asserted |
| * \retval 0 No signals are asserted. This case is only seen if |
| * caller used a polling timeout |
| * \retval "Does not return" The call is invalid, one or more of the following |
| * are true: |
| * \arg signal_mask does not include any interrupt or |
| * doorbell signals |
| * \arg signal_mask includes one or more RoT Service |
| * signals |
| */ |
| uint32_t psa_wait_interrupt(psa_signal_t signal_mask, uint32_t timeout); |
| |
| /** |
| * \brief Get the message which corresponds to a given RoT Service signal |
| * and remove the message from the RoT Service queue. |
| * |
| * \param[in] signal The signal value for an asserted RoT Service |
| * \param[out] msg Pointer to \ref psa_msg_t object for receiving |
| * the message |
| * |
| * \retval void Success |
| * \retval "Does not return" The call is invalid because one or more of the |
| * following are true: |
| * \arg signal has more than a single bit set |
| * \arg signal does not correspond to a RoT Service |
| * \arg The RoT Service signal is not currently asserted |
| * \arg The msg pointer provided is not a valid memory |
| * reference |
| */ |
| void psa_get(psa_signal_t signal, psa_msg_t *msg); |
| |
| /** |
| * \brief Get the Partition ID of the sender of a message. |
| * |
| * \param[in] msg_handle Message handle for an incoming message |
| * |
| * \retval >0 ID of a Secure Partition |
| * \retval <0 ID of an NSPE client |
| * \retval "Does not return" msg_handle is invalid |
| * |
| * \note Bit[31] is set if the caller is from the NSPE. |
| */ |
| int32_t psa_identity(psa_handle_t msg_handle); |
| |
| /** |
| * \brief Associates some caller-provided private data with a specified client |
| * connection. |
| * |
| * \param[in] msg_handle Handle for the client's message |
| * \param[in] rhandle Reverse handle allocated by the RoT Service |
| * |
| * \retval void Success, rhandle will be provided with all |
| * subsequent messages delivered on this connection |
| * \retval "Does not return" msg_handle is invalid |
| */ |
| void psa_set_rhandle(psa_handle_t msg_handle, void *rhandle); |
| |
| /** |
| * \brief Read a message parameter or part of a message parameter from the |
| * client input vector. |
| * |
| * \param[in] msg_handle Handle for the client's message |
| * \param[in] invec_idx Index of the input vector to read from. Must be |
| * less than \ref PSA_MAX_IOVEC |
| * \param[out] buffer Buffer in the Secure Partition to copy the |
| * requested data to |
| * \param[in] num_bytes Maximum number of bytes to be read from the client |
| * input vector |
| * |
| * \retval >0 Number of bytes copied |
| * \retval 0 There was no remaining data in this input vector |
| * \retval "Does not return" The call is invalid, one or more of the following |
| * are true: |
| * \arg msg_handle is invalid |
| * \arg msg_handle does not refer to a \ref PSA_IPC_CALL |
| * message |
| * \arg invec_idx is equal to or greater than |
| * PSA_MAX_IOVEC |
| * \arg the memory reference for buffer is invalid or |
| * not writable |
| */ |
| size_t psa_read(psa_handle_t msg_handle, uint32_t invec_idx, |
| void *buffer, size_t num_bytes); |
| |
| /** |
| * \brief Skip a given number of bytes for an input vector. |
| * |
| * \param[in] msg_handle Handle for the client's message |
| * \param[in] invec_idx Index of input vector in message to skip from. |
| * Must be less than \ref PSA_MAX_IOVEC |
| * \param[in] num_bytes Maximum number of bytes to skip in the client input |
| * vector |
| * |
| * \retval >0 Number of bytes skipped |
| * \retval 0 There was no remaining data in this input vector |
| * \retval "Does not return" The call is invalid, one or more of the following |
| * are true: |
| * \arg msg_handle is invalid |
| * \arg msg_handle does not refer to a \ref PSA_IPC_CALL |
| * message |
| * \arg invec_idx is equal to or greater than |
| * PSA_MAX_IOVEC |
| */ |
| size_t psa_skip(psa_handle_t msg_handle, uint32_t invec_idx, size_t num_bytes); |
| |
| /** |
| * \brief Write a message response to the client output vector. |
| * |
| * \param[in] msg_handle Handle for the client's message |
| * \param[out] outvec_idx Index of output vector in message to write to. |
| * Must be less than \ref PSA_MAX_IOVEC |
| * \param[in] buffer Buffer with the data to write |
| * \param[in] num_bytes Number of bytes to write to the client output |
| * vector |
| * |
| * \retval void Success |
| * \retval "Does not return" The call is invalid, one or more of the following |
| * are true: |
| * \arg msg_handle is invalid |
| * \arg msg_handle does not refer to a \ref PSA_IPC_CALL |
| * message |
| * \arg outvec_idx is equal to or greater than |
| * \ref PSA_MAX_IOVEC |
| * \arg the memory reference for buffer is invalid |
| * \arg the call attempts to write data past the end of |
| * the client output vector |
| */ |
| void psa_write(psa_handle_t msg_handle, uint32_t outvec_idx, |
| const void *buffer, size_t num_bytes); |
| |
| /** |
| * \brief Completes handling of a specific message and unblocks the client. |
| * |
| * \param[in] msg_handle Handle for the client's message or the null handle |
| * \param[in] retval Return value to be reported to the client |
| * |
| * \retval void Success |
| * \retval "Does not return" The call is invalid, one or more of the following |
| * are true: |
| * \arg msg_handle is invalid and is not the null handle |
| * \arg An invalid return code is specified for the type |
| * of message |
| */ |
| void psa_end(psa_handle_t msg_handle, psa_error_t retval); |
| |
| /** |
| * \brief Sends a PSA_DOORBELL signal to a specific Secure Partition. |
| * |
| * \param[in] partition_id Secure Partition ID of the target partition |
| * |
| * \retval void Success |
| * \retval "Does not return" partition_id does not correspond to a Secure |
| * Partition |
| */ |
| void psa_notify(int32_t partition_id); |
| |
| /** |
| * \brief Clears the PSA_DOORBELL signal. |
| * |
| * \param[in] void |
| * |
| * \retval void Success |
| * \retval "Does not return" The Secure Partition's doorbell signal is not |
| * currently asserted |
| */ |
| void psa_clear(void); |
| |
| /** |
| * \brief Informs the SPM that an interrupt has been handled (end of interrupt). |
| * |
| * \param[in] irq_signal The interrupt signal that has been processed |
| * |
| * \retval void Success |
| * \retval "Does not return" The call is invalid, one or more of the following |
| * are true: |
| * \arg irq_signal is not an interrupt signal |
| * \arg irq_signal indicates more than one signal |
| * \arg irq_signal is not currently asserted |
| */ |
| void psa_eoi(uint32_t irq_signal); |
